About The Position

The Clinical Cytogenetics Laboratory handles approximately 10,000 specimens per year, performing chromosome analysis, fluorescence in-situ hybridization (FISH), and microarray analysis. This high complexity testing involves diverse requirements for reporting and specimen handling, adhering to National Patient Safety Goals, OSHA, CLIA, and Joint Commission Regulations. Responsibilities

  • Log in samples and review submitted clinical data to allow appropriate pre-analytic triage of specimens.
  • Perform assigned tissue culture and wet lab duties and assist with maintaining equipment, supplies, and reagent stocks.
  • Demonstrate technical expertise in FISH analysis: Perform all aspects of specimen processing; analyze metaphases or interphase nuclei and record hybridization patterns; capture representative images at the fluorescence microscope workstation.
  • Teach rotating residents and fellows and train new employees when assigned.
  • Participate in scheduled technical meetings and assigned CAP proficiency testing.
  • Participate in quality assurance activities, such as assisting with new assay and equipment validation and periodic updates to standard operating protocols.
